Description

【0001】
【発明の属する技術分野】
本発明は、サッシの上下枠に設けられた網戸用上下レール間にけんどん式に装着される網戸の外れを防ぐための網戸用外れ止めに関し、更に詳しくはサッシ上枠から垂下された網戸用上部レールを網戸上框の上方に長手方向に平行に突出された屋内側,屋外側の上部突出部材間に挟み込んで網戸を装着した状態で、網戸上框の上方への移動代を規制して網戸の外れを防ぐための一体成形された網戸用外れ止めに関するものである。
【0002】
【従来の技術】
従来から建築物の窓や出入口の開閉する障子の最外側に防虫用として網戸が設けられている。この網戸はガラス障子のように常時使用するものではなく夏期等の虫が発生し易い時期のみに使用するものであるので安価で且つ取外しが便利なように軽量であることが要求される結果、簡単にサッシ枠から外れてしまうことがしばしばある。
【0003】
一般に、網戸の装着はサッシ枠に設けられている網戸用上下のレール間へ「けんどん式」により、即ちサッシ上枠から垂下された網戸用上部レールを網戸上框の上方に平行に突設された屋内側,屋外側の上部突出部材間に挟み込むように持ち上げた後にサッシ下枠から突出されている網戸用下部レール上に網戸の下框内に装着されている戸車が載置されるように網戸を下ろす方式により行われているが、装着した後は網戸上框における屋内側,屋外側の上部突出部材の基部間の水平部材上面とサッシ上枠から垂下された網戸用上部レール下端との間にはかなりの隙間がある。この隙間が存在するために網戸をけんどん式にの着脱ができるのであるが、またこれが網戸の外れの原因になる。
【0004】
例えば図9の網戸を装着した状態のサッシを示す断面図に示すように、網戸7は、サッシ上枠1から垂下されている網戸用上部レール3を網戸上框9の上方に長手方向全長に亘って突設された屋内側,屋外側の上部突出部材12,13で挟み込むように持ち上げた後に網戸下框16内に装着されている戸車17をサッシ下枠2に突出されている網戸用下部レール4上に下ろす「けんどん式」で装着される。この状態において網戸上框9における屋内側,屋外側の上部突出部材12,13の基部間の水平部材10の上面とサッシ上枠1から垂下された網戸用上部レール3下端との間に隙間が存在するため、網戸7は上方に移動できるので、網戸7の走行中の一寸した振動等により戸車17がサッシ下枠2から突出されている網戸用下部レール4上から完全に脱落したり、片方の戸車17が外れて網戸7がゆがんで動かなくなることがある。
【0005】
そこで、このような現象が生じないようにするために、従来は網戸上框の上方への移動代を規制するために上下方向に長孔を形成した板状の網戸用外れ止めを、その上端がサッシ上枠の水平部分下面から僅かに下方に位置するように配置し前記長孔を挿通したビスを網戸上框の上方に突出された屋内側の上部突出部材の所定位置に螺設したメネジに螺着して挟持固定することによって、サッシ上枠に固定する方法が採用されていた。
【0006】
しかしながら、この方法では網戸用外れ止めの取付高さ位置を調整する際にビスを回転させるためのドライバーを用意しなければならないばかりか、網戸用外れ止めの位置が網戸上框の最上部に位置するため網戸用外れ止めの取付高さ位置を調整する際には脚立のようなものを用意しなければならず、しかもビスの締め付けが弱いと重力により網戸用外れ止めが下方に下がって来てその役目をなさなくなり、ビスの締め付けが強いと網戸用外れ止めが破損してしまうという欠点があった。
【0007】
【発明が解決しようとする課題】
このような従来の網戸用外れ止めの欠点を解決し、一体成形されているので構造が簡単で、特別の道具を用意しなくても指先で操作して網戸用外れ止めの取付高さ位置調整を容易に行って網戸上框の上方への移動代を規制する外れ止め効果を確実に機能させることができるばかりか、網戸に装着されている網の上部近傍という低い位置で網戸用外れ止めの取付高さ位置調整を行うことができ、しかも網戸の清掃や冬期等の不使用時は簡単に外れ止め効果を解除できる網戸用外れ止めを提供することを課題とする。

[0001]
BACKGROUND OF THE INVENTION
TECHNICAL FIELD The present invention relates to a screen door detachment preventer for preventing the screen doors to be detached between the upper and lower screen door rails provided on the upper and lower frames of the sash, and more particularly for screen doors suspended from the sash upper frame. While the upper rail is sandwiched between the indoor and outdoor upper projecting members projecting parallel to the longitudinal direction above the screen doorway, the screen door is attached, and the movement allowance of the screen door upward is restricted. The present invention relates to an integrally formed screen door stopper for preventing the screen door from coming off.
[0002]
[Prior art]
Conventionally, a screen door is provided for insect control on the outermost side of the shoji that opens and closes the windows and doors of the building. This screen door is not always used like a glass shoji, but is used only during periods when insects are likely to occur, such as in summer, so it is required to be inexpensive and lightweight so that it can be easily removed. Often it can easily fall off the sash frame.
[0003]
In general, the screen door is installed between the upper and lower screen door rails provided on the sash frame by the “Kendon method”, that is, the upper screen door rail hanging from the sash upper frame is projected in parallel above the screen door ridge. The door cart mounted in the lower arm of the screen door is placed on the lower rail for the screen door protruding from the sash lower frame after being lifted so as to be sandwiched between the indoor and outdoor upper protruding members. After installing, the horizontal door upper surface between the base part of the indoor and outdoor upper projecting members and the lower end of the upper door rail for the screen door suspended from the sash upper frame There is a considerable gap between them. Because of the presence of this gap, the screen door can be attached and detached quickly, but this also causes the screen door to come off.
[0004]
For example, as shown in the sectional view of the sash with the screen door of FIG. 9 attached, the screen door 7 has the screen door upper rail 3 suspended from the sash upper frame 1 in the longitudinal direction over the screen door ridge 9. A lower part for a screen door in which a door wheel 17 mounted in a screen door sill 16 is projected to the sash lower frame 2 after being lifted so as to be sandwiched between the indoor-side and outdoor-side upper projecting members 12, 13. Mounted on the rail 4 by “Kendon type”. In this state, there is a gap between the upper surface of the horizontal member 10 between the base portions of the indoor and outdoor upper projecting members 12 and 13 in the screen door ridge 9 and the lower end of the screen door upper rail 3 suspended from the sash upper frame 1. Since the screen door 7 can be moved upward, the door wheel 17 is completely dropped from the screen door lower rail 4 protruding from the sash lower frame 2 due to a slight vibration or the like while the screen door 7 is running. The door wheel 17 may come off and the screen door 7 may be distorted and cannot move.
[0005]
Therefore, in order to prevent such a phenomenon from occurring, a plate-shaped screen door stopper that has a long hole in the vertical direction in order to regulate the upward movement allowance of the screen door ridge is conventionally used. Is a screw threaded at a predetermined position on an indoor upper projecting member that is projected above the screen door ridge, and is arranged so that is positioned slightly below the lower surface of the horizontal portion of the sash upper frame. A method of fixing to a sash upper frame by screwing and fixing to a sash upper frame has been adopted.
[0006]
However, this method not only requires a screwdriver to rotate the screw when adjusting the installation height position of the screen door stopper, but also the position of the screen door stopper is at the top of the screen door ridge. Therefore, when adjusting the installation height position of the screen door stopper, you must prepare a stepladder, and if the screws are weak, the screen door stopper will drop downward due to gravity. There was a disadvantage that the screen door detachment was damaged when the screw was not tightened and the screws were tightened strongly.
